The Endgame Gear Op1We mouse has gained popularity among gamers and professionals alike for its remarkable light weight and speed. These features are not just marketing claims but are rooted in scientific principles that enhance performance and reduce fatigue during extended use.
Design and Material Science
The Op1We’s lightweight design is achieved through the use of advanced materials such as polycarbonate and aluminum. These materials are chosen for their high strength-to-weight ratio, allowing the mouse to be durable yet light. The internal structure minimizes unnecessary mass without compromising structural integrity.
Material Properties and Impact on Weight
Polycarbonate is a thermoplastic polymer known for its toughness and lightness. Aluminum, on the other hand, provides rigidity without adding significant weight. Combining these materials results in a mouse that weighs approximately 66 grams, significantly lighter than traditional gaming mice.
Ergonomics and Reduced Fatigue
Light weight reduces the physical effort required to move the mouse, leading to less fatigue during prolonged gaming sessions. This is supported by biomechanical studies showing that lighter objects require less muscular force, decreasing strain on the wrist and arm muscles.
Speed and Response Time
The Op1We’s design emphasizes minimal inertia, which is the resistance to change in motion. Lower inertia means the mouse can accelerate and decelerate more quickly, providing faster response times. This is essential for competitive gaming where milliseconds matter.
Sensor Technology and Precision
The mouse incorporates high-precision optical sensors that detect even the slightest movements. The combination of lightweight construction and advanced sensor technology ensures that every motion is registered accurately, enhancing user control and reaction speed.
Impact of Sensor Accuracy on Speed
Precise sensors reduce the need for exaggerated movements, allowing for swift and accurate actions. This synergy between hardware and design optimizes speed, giving gamers a competitive edge.
